TARAR |
Top |
Copia el valor de la entrada de celda a una variable interna no accesible llamada Tara. Este valor es restado al valor de la entrada de celda y el resultado queda en sm12. Esta función es exclusiva del CP121 y CP123 y es de ejecución incondicional.
Cuando se ejecuta la
instrucción: Tara = Entrada_Celda
Función dentro del PLC: Valor_Final = Entrada_Celda - Tara
En algunos, como el CP121 BIOS 2.08, esta instrucción también afecta a la entrada no filtrada (ai0_nf). Para el caso mencionado, el resultado se lee en sm18 (16 bit) o en sm18 y sm19 (32 bit). En algunos modelos debe observarse el valor máximo leído para ésta. Consultar el área de memoria correspondiente a cada modelo.
A partir de la BIOS 2.07 y 1.11 del CP121 el valor de tara está en el área SM
A partir de CP121 2.70, CP123 2.30 la ejecución es condicional.
En varias versiones y equipos hubo problemas con la instrucción o el valor de tara. Consultar lista de fallas conocidas.
CP08WG Ejecutada sin argumentos realiza la tara de todas las entradas. Pero se puede especificar una o varias mediante el argumento:
Si es mas de una entrada, se suman los valores correspondientes, y se usa como argumento. Lo mismo es para el caso de que el argumento sea una variable: el valor de la variable se comporta de la misma forma.
|